This is going to be a unique experience. You can discover the region and the wines of it with a local winemaker that own a winery.
The target is to show you the differences in the type of soils, exposure of the vineyards, the varieties that we grow here in this part of Piedmont in connection with the global warming of the last decades.
Last but not least, taste some of the fantastic wines of this region in the company of local producers after visiting their cellars .
and discover their production techniques.

Torre di Barbaresco
Barbaresco is one of the picturesque towns we will pass through on our wine tour.
La Morra
Here in the beautiful town of La Morra we will stop to have lunch at a traditional Piemontese restaurant. Being the highest town on the Barolo wine making region it is the perfect place to stop and enjoy lunch while taking in the scenic view.
